About This Denver, CO Facility

Solace Counseling Services is located in Denver, Colorado and provides compassionate, personalized care for individuals struggling with addiction, substance abuse, and related disorders. They offer a multi-faceted approach that combines evidence-based counseling and therapy techniques with holistic healing practices. This allows their clients to obtain the support they need in order to make positive changes in their lives. Their staff is highly trained and includes psychiatrists, psychologists, counselors, and therapists.

At Solace Counseling Services, clients can receive individual, couple, and family therapy. These services focus on relapse prevention, cognitive/behavioral therapy, mindfulness-based relapse prevention, and evidence-based counseling. In addition, they provide comprehensive assessments to develop personalized treatment plans, aftercare services, and recovery coaching. They also offer intensive outpatient and partial hospitalization programs for clients who require more intensive interventions.

Solace Counseling Services is accredited by the Joint Commission and is licensed by the Colorado Department of Human Services to provide potential clients with quality, professional care. They also have a commitment to providing effective, affordable care and have partnered with several insurance companies to ensure the cost of treatment is kept to a minimum. Additionally, they have been honored with the 2020 Psychology Today “Therapy Awards Top 10," recognizing them as one of the best facilities for addiction rehabilitation in the Denver area.

    Dialectical behavior therapy (DBT) is a method of individual and/or group counseling that focuses on acceptance and change. DBT can be very effective in developing coping strategies for negative emotions.

    C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T) is a way of addressing concerns through talking. Talking through issues can identify sources of discomfort or unhealthy thoughts. CBT is a healthy way Solace Counseling Services addresses some behaviors which may be bringing unintended consequences in a persons life.

    Rational Emotive Behavior Therapy (REBT) is a type of cognitive therapy. It is based on the principle that irrational thoughts are responsible for the emotional and behavioral changes in addiction. The therapy starts with identifying the underlying irrational thoughts. These thoughts are then challenged and opposed logically and then replaced with positive thoughts.

    The 12 step program is the treatment method used by Alcoholics Anonymous, but it can apply to any type of addiction. It outlines the 12 steps addicts should take on the path to recovery. Steps include admitting you have a problem and making the decision to turn your life around. A belief in a higher power and making amends to others are also part of the program.

    Contingency Management (CM), also known as “Motivational Incentives,” is a type of behavioral therapy rooted and based on the concept of operant conditioning, which refers to the behavior shaped in its consequences. This type of treatment intends to give positive compensations in response to a patient’s behavior, such as proper medications and undergoing various drug tests. It can be inferred that this treatment has been effective in curing and lessening a scale of profound issues, which include impulsive behaviors, rebelliousness, and even drug and substance abuse. Given its capability of successful remedy, Contingency Management can also be used alongside other treatment styles at Solace Counseling Services in Denver, Colorado or even in stand-alone approaches.

    Denver, Colorado Addiction Information

    The Centennial State has slipped to a ranking of 12th in the country for drug abuse. Each year around 24% of the state's population uses illegal drugs while nearly 5% of its population abuses alcohol. Substance-related deaths in Colorado were responsible for 15.12% between 2008 and 2017. Fortunately, Colorado drug and alcohol addiction treatment are available to help a person overcome addiction.

    Drug addiction in Denver, Colorado, is quite serious. In 2012, there were 974 drug overdose fatalities in the area, which has likely only gone up in recent years. The city has an estimated 34,000 marijuana users reporting past-month usage in 2016. The most common drugs abused are methamphetamine, heroin, and marijuana. Some popular treatment options include inpatient rehab, outpatient rehab, and detoxification programs.
